ncurses 6.2 - patch 20210626
[ncurses.git] / panel / llib-lpanel
index de49c234ecaa9fd706af3c71b285b2c118ad5277..afdea20c3db2616d298842d0b6771ada054f2efe 100644 (file)
@@ -1,5 +1,6 @@
 /****************************************************************************
- * Copyright (c) 1998-2002,2005 Free Software Foundation, Inc.              *
+ * Copyright 2020,2021 Thomas E. Dickey                                     *
+ * Copyright 1998-2010,2015 Free Software Foundation, Inc.                  *
  *                                                                          *
  * Permission is hereby granted, free of charge, to any person obtaining a  *
  * copy of this software and associated documentation files (the            *
  ****************************************************************************/
 
 /****************************************************************************
- *  Author: Thomas E. Dickey        1997,2002,2005                          *
+ *  Author: Thomas E. Dickey       1996-on                                  *
  ****************************************************************************/
 /* LINTLIBRARY */
 
 /* ./panel.c */
 
-#include "panel.priv.h"
+#include <panel.priv.h>
 
 #undef _nc_retrace_panel
 PANEL  *_nc_retrace_panel(
@@ -42,19 +43,20 @@ PANEL       *_nc_retrace_panel(
 
 #undef _nc_my_visbuf
 const char *_nc_my_visbuf(
-               const void *ptr)
+               const void *ptr,
+               int     n)
                { return(*(const char **)0); }
 
 #undef _nc_dPanel
 void   _nc_dPanel(
-               const char *text, 
+               const char *text,
                const PANEL *pan)
                { /* void */ }
 
 #undef _nc_dStack
 void   _nc_dStack(
-               const char *fmt, 
-               int     num, 
+               const char *fmt,
+               int     num,
                const PANEL *pan)
                { /* void */ }
 
@@ -70,13 +72,18 @@ void        _nc_Touchpan(
 
 #undef _nc_Touchline
 void   _nc_Touchline(
-               const PANEL *pan, 
-               int     start, 
+               const PANEL *pan,
+               int     start,
                int     count)
                { /* void */ }
 
 /* ./p_above.c */
 
+#undef ground_panel
+PANEL  *ground_panel(
+               SCREEN  *sp)
+               { return(*(PANEL **)0); }
+
 #undef panel_above
 PANEL  *panel_above(
                const PANEL *pan)
@@ -84,6 +91,11 @@ PANEL        *panel_above(
 
 /* ./p_below.c */
 
+#undef ceiling_panel
+PANEL  *ceiling_panel(
+               SCREEN  *sp)
+               { return(*(PANEL **)0); }
+
 #undef panel_below
 PANEL  *panel_below(
                const PANEL *pan)
@@ -121,8 +133,8 @@ int panel_hidden(
 
 #undef move_panel
 int    move_panel(
-               PANEL   *pan, 
-               int     starty, 
+               PANEL   *pan,
+               int     starty,
                int     startx)
                { return(*(int *)0); }
 
@@ -137,7 +149,7 @@ PANEL       *new_panel(
 
 #undef replace_panel
 int    replace_panel(
-               PANEL   *pan, 
+               PANEL   *pan,
                WINDOW  *win)
                { return(*(int *)0); }
 
@@ -157,6 +169,11 @@ int        top_panel(
 
 /* ./p_update.c */
 
+#undef update_panels_sp
+void   update_panels_sp(
+               SCREEN  *sp)
+               { /* void */ }
+
 #undef update_panels
 void   update_panels(void)
                { /* void */ }
@@ -165,14 +182,14 @@ void      update_panels(void)
 
 #undef set_panel_userptr
 int    set_panel_userptr(
-               PANEL   *pan, 
-               void    *uptr)
+               PANEL   *pan,
+               const void *uptr)
                { return(*(int *)0); }
 
 #undef panel_userptr
-void   *panel_userptr(
+const void *panel_userptr(
                const PANEL *pan)
-               { return(*(void **)0); }
+               { return(*(const void **)0); }
 
 /* ./p_win.c */